The structural highlights of this protein are four: the six subdomains that compose the protein, the binding site in domain II for salicylates, sulfonamides and several drug ingredients, the bilirubin binding site at position 264, and the free cysteine in the structure of the protein <ref> PMID: 32162429</ref>.

The shared binding site in domain II between zinc and calcium at residue Asp 273 suggests a crosstalk between zinc and calcium transport in the blood.
